Bug 439557

Summary: Floating preview appears when dragging something into a folder even when the feature has been disabled
Product: [Plasma] plasmashell Reporter: Unknown <null>
Component: FolderAssignee: Eike Hein <hein>
Status: RESOLVED FIXED    
Severity: normal CC: nate, plasma-bugs
Priority: NOR    
Version: 5.22.2   
Target Milestone: 1.0   
Platform: Neon   
OS: Linux   
Latest Commit: Version Fixed In: 5.23
Attachments: picture 1
picture 2

Description Unknown 2021-07-06 13:26:38 UTC
SUMMARY
The floating preview of folders on the desktop is always active even if the option is unchecked in the desktop configuration.


EXPECTED RESULT
Do not have a floating preview of folders on the desktop if the option is unchecked.

SOFTWARE/OS VERSIONS
Operating System: KDE neon 5.22
KDE Plasma Version: 5.22.2
KDE Frameworks Version: 5.83.0
Qt Version: 5.15.3
Kernel Version: 5.8.0-59-generic (64-bit)
Graphics Platform: X11
Comment 1 Nate Graham 2021-07-30 16:36:13 UTC
So you unchecked "Folder Preview popups" but they are still appearing? Can you attach a screen recording that shows this happening?
Comment 2 Unknown 2021-08-02 08:45:00 UTC
Created attachment 140460 [details]
picture 1
Comment 3 Unknown 2021-08-02 08:45:13 UTC
Created attachment 140461 [details]
picture 2
Comment 4 Nate Graham 2021-08-02 15:40:31 UTC
Ah, then dragging something into a folder. Can confirm.
Comment 5 Bug Janitor Service 2021-08-05 21:53:48 UTC
A possibly relevant merge request was started @ https://invent.kde.org/plasma/plasma-desktop/-/merge_requests/540
Comment 6 Nate Graham 2021-08-08 18:00:07 UTC
Git commit d621c15fc7b9d62250fa9df420933477b0636e53 by Nate Graham.
Committed on 08/08/2021 at 17:59.
Pushed by ngraham into branch 'master'.

[Folder View] When folder previews are disabled, disable them on hover too

It's logical that if the user disables this feature, they want it off
everywhere, not just in one of the two places where it can currently
appear.
FIXED-IN: 5.23

M  +1    -1    containments/desktop/package/contents/ui/FolderView.qml

https://invent.kde.org/plasma/plasma-desktop/commit/d621c15fc7b9d62250fa9df420933477b0636e53